Introducing in a video! A non-contact capacitive liquid level sensor capable of detecting micro-capacity levels for scientific analysis equipment.
We will introduce the operating status of the "CLA-D10P40" using a demo unit in a video. This product captures even minute changes of 10pF without missing them. When there are no external influences such as temperature changes, it can also measure capacitance changes below 10pF. 【Specifications (Electrode Section)】 ■ Model: CLA-D10P40 ■ Compatible Pipe Diameter: Φ10mm (Depending on the installation method, can accommodate from 10φ to flat surface) ■ Liquid Level Range: 0–40mm ■ Standard Cable Length: 1m (Outer diameter φ2.8 vinyl single-core wire + outer diameter φ2.9 via coaxial) ■ Operating Temperature Range: 0–40℃ ■ Operating Humidity Range: 35–75% RH ■ Insulation Resistance: 50MΩ or more between lead wires and electrode surface (measured with 500V DC megger) ■ Dielectric Strength: AC 500V (50/60Hz) for 1 minute between lead wires and electrode surface ■ Protection Structure: IP-63 *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

Kameoka Electronics Co., Ltd. is a sensor manufacturer located in Kameoka City, Kyoto Prefecture. Since the fiscal year 2010, it has been offering its own products, and through production outsourcing, it has established a comprehensive system for various sensors such as assembly, mounting, and resin, enabling high-quality manufacturing.
